The video tutorial teaches how to summarize a poem by analyzing each stanza. It uses the poem '74th Street' by Myra Cohn Livingston as an example. The process involves reading each stanza, summarizing it, and then combining these summaries to create an overall summary of the poem. The tutorial emphasizes the importance of understanding the main idea of each stanza and how it contributes to the poem's overall meaning.
